Cover Supervisor job summary

We currently have a new opportunity for a dynamic and flexible Cover Supervisor to support our staff and students by delivering lessons and supervision.

Job overview

You’ll be an expert in deploying classroom management skills, enabling students to achieve their lesson objectives whilst offering appropriate support where needed and helping to assist the wider faculty when teaching staff are otherwise engaged.

The right candidate will have:

  • Experience of working with students in an educational or service environment
  • Minimum of 3 GCSEs at grade C or above (including Maths and English)
  • Solid communication skills and the ability to successfully manage classroom behaviour and focus
  • Ability to prioritise and plan workload, delivering set lesson content effectively and efficiently and identifying opportunities for further support where appropriate.

Why Oasis Academy Leesbrook?

You’ll make a key difference in student’s progression with the ability to experience a leading role in the classroom, working as part of a wider team, with access to further developmental opportunities available.

Our Academy opened in September 2018 with 230 students across year groups 7 and 8 and has grown year on year. Currently, we have 1,118 students on roll. We are an Ofsted rated ‘Good’ school and a school of choice within Oldham. At Oasis Academy Leesbrook, we pride ourselves on having a staff body who are committed and dedicated, going above and beyond to serve our children and community.
